Torque Converter Shudder: Causes, Symptoms, and How to Fix It
Key Takeaways
- Torque converter shudder is a vibration felt when the converter fails to smoothly transfer power.
- Common causes include worn clutch, degraded ATF, or overheating.
- Often occurs at 25-50 mph during overdrive.
- Fix typically starts with an ATF change; if that fails, converter replacement may be needed.
